THE Ayeyawady Bridge (Aunglan-Thayet) construction project is located in the Thayet District of the Magway Region. The bridge will link Aunglan and Thayet townships. The bridge construction task force (3) of the Bridge Department under the Ministry of Construction constructs the bridge and is now complete 50 per cent.

THE Kyaukpyu combined cycle power plant project with a capacity of 135 mW will be completed in May 2023, according to the Kyaukpyu District Electric Power Generation Enterprise.
